#0e2ddc h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#0e2ddc is composed of 5.5% red, 17.6%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.6% cyan, 79.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 231 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 45.9%. #0e2ddc color hex could be obtained by blending #1c5aff with #0000b9.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

● #0e2ddc color description : Vivid blue.
The hexadecimal color #0e2ddc has RGB values of R:14, G:45,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 929244.
